The first feature that seems to be rumored from every site on the Internet is a change to the dock connector in the next iPhone. This is likely to happen, as the current dock connector has been part of Apple devices now for about 8 years, since the release of the original iPod. The thin 30-pin connector is famous for being the Apple connection of choice for its portable devices. It has been on everything from the iPod Nano to the current iPad. Now, according to the rumors, Apple is thinking it is probably time for a change - the rumor first appeared from iLounge and then it was repeated in iMore. Finally, it was repeated again in a recent article from 9to5 Mac, who have apparently got a source from inside the Apple campus. The rumor states that the dock connector will roughly halve in size and that Apple will more than likely make this new one standard across all their new devices. However, the article didn't mention if there was going to be any changes to the data speed of the connector.
The rumor sites have also mentioned the physical shape of the next Apple smartphone. The rumors state that the device will be thinner than the current model, yet maintain the rectangular shape. This is different to rumors earlier in the year that suggested the next iPhone might have more of a curved shape.
The final big rumor coming from the Armenante Apple news site is about the size of the screen that will be in the next iPhone. Earlier in the year there were rumors going round that stated that the next phone would have a 4 inch screen instead of the current 3.5 inch one. Rumors from the insider source at 9to5 Mac have said that it will be a 3.9 inch one. Given that this will be very close to 4 inch, the resolution that this screen will offer will be a lot higher than the current retina display at 640 x 1136. It was also worked out by 9to5 Mac that if these things were taken into account it would give the screen a 16:9 aspect ratio. This is significant mainly because that 16:9 aspect ratio is more commonly known as wide screen, so this means that wide screen video would be able to be natively played on the iPhone 5 if these rumors are true.
